Sunzz

Jenkins忘记密码

1、先找到enkins/config.xml文件,并备份。此文件位于Jenkins系统设置的主目录
/data/temp/jenkins/config.xml
2、然后编辑config.xml
删除<useSecurity>true</useSecurity>至</securityRealm>,中间内容应该会不同。

<useSecurity>true</useSecurity>
<authorizationStrategy class="hudson.security.FullControlOnceLoggedInAuthorizationStrategy">
<denyAnonymousReadAccess>true</denyAnonymousReadAccess>
</authorizationStrategy>
<securityRealm class="hudson.security.HudsonPrivateSecurityRealm">
<disableSignup>true</disableSignup>
<enableCaptcha>false</enableCaptcha>
</securityRealm>

重启
[root@jenkins ]# /opt/tomcat/bin/catalina.sh stop
[root@jenkins ]# /opt/tomcat/bin/catalina.sh start
3、登录jenkins—系统管理,允许用户注册

 

4、注册完成之后加入管理员

 

5、在重置管理员密码

 

6、恢复配置文件并重启
把备份的config.xml在再复制回去,然后启动tomcat
[root@jenkins ]# /opt/tomcat/bin/catalina.sh start

posted on 2018-10-16 17:15 Sunzz 阅读(...) 评论(...) 编辑 收藏

相关文章:

  • 2021-11-19
  • 2021-07-09
  • 2021-05-09
  • 2021-06-21
  • 2021-11-07
  • 2021-11-07
  • 2021-11-07
  • 2022-12-23
猜你喜欢
  • 2021-11-02
  • 2021-12-23
  • 2021-11-09
  • 2021-06-26
  • 2021-05-18
  • 2020-07-07
相关资源
相似解决方案